Market Definition
The power factor correction refers to the utilization of capacitor banks that are designed to improve the efficiency of an electrical power system by compensating for the lagging power factor caused by inductive loads such as motors, transformers, and other inductive devices. Capacitor banks are strategically installed to supply reactive power (kVArs) to the system, which reduces the amount of reactive power that needs to be supplied by the utility, thereby improving the power factor. These solutions improve the power factor in electrical systems, reducing energy losses, enhancing efficiency, and minimizing penalties from utilities.
